Antonio Williams-Parker is a basketball player born on December 28, 1982 in Oakland, ca. His height is six foot (1m82 / 6-0). He is a point guard / shooting guard who most recently played for Jackson State Tigers in NCAA.

Antonio Williams-Parker - Points
Antonio Williams-Parker scores a career high 23 points (2005)
On February 19, 2005, Antonio Williams-Parker set his career high in points in a NCAA game. That day he scored 23 points in Jackson State Tigers's home win against Grambling State Tigers, 62-58. He also had 4 rebounds, 2 assists, 2 steals. He shot 3/5 from two, 5/9 from three, shooting at 57.1% from the field. He also shot 2/3 from the free-throw line.
Antonio Williams-Parker - Rebounds
Antonio Williams-Parker grabs a career high 8 rebounds (2004)
On December 29, 2004, Antonio Williams-Parker set his career high in rebounds in a NCAA game. That day he grabbed 8 rebounds in Jackson State Tigers's home win against Nicholls State Colonels, 76-61. He also had 16 points, 2 assists, 2 steals.
Antonio Williams-Parker - Assists
Antonio Williams-Parker gives a career high 5 assists (2004)
On February 09, 2004, Antonio Williams-Parker tied his career high in assists in a NCAA game. That day he dished 5 assists in Jackson State Tigers's home win against Southern Jaguars, 81-73. He also had 8 points, 3 rebounds, 1 steal.
Antonio Williams-Parker - Steals
Antonio Williams-Parker has a career high 4 steals (2004)
On January 03, 2004, Antonio Williams-Parker set his career high in steals in a NCAA game. That day he reached 4 steals in Jackson State Tigers's home win against Alabama A&M Bulldogs, 86-79. He also had 9 points, 1 rebound and 4 assists.
